How they compare

Indonesia currently reports 52,230 SDR per square kilometre against 49,447 SDR per square kilometre in Honduras, a difference of 2,783 SDR per square kilometre.

That makes Indonesia's figure about 1.1 times Honduras's.

The two have swapped places 7 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Honduras ahead.

Honduras ranks 89th and Indonesia ranks 88th of 179 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Honduras averaged higher in 3 and Indonesia in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Honduras Indonesia Difference Ahead
1960s 184.53 SDR per square kilometre 26.51 SDR per square kilometre 158.02 SDR per square kilometre Honduras
1970s 651.05 SDR per square kilometre 610.34 SDR per square kilometre 40.7 SDR per square kilometre Honduras
1980s 760.55 SDR per square kilometre 2,079 SDR per square kilometre 1,319 SDR per square kilometre Indonesia
1990s 2,413 SDR per square kilometre 5,706 SDR per square kilometre 3,293 SDR per square kilometre Indonesia
2000s 11,803 SDR per square kilometre 14,226 SDR per square kilometre 2,423 SDR per square kilometre Indonesia
2010s 22,167 SDR per square kilometre 39,534 SDR per square kilometre 17,367 SDR per square kilometre Indonesia
2020s 51,640 SDR per square kilometre 49,656 SDR per square kilometre 1,984 SDR per square kilometre Honduras

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
